Run the command from a non-X terminal. CTRL + ALT + F2 should get you to a normal console. WebThe dollar sign is a prompt, which shows us that the shell is waiting for input; your shell may use a different character as a prompt and may add information before the prompt.When typing commands, either from these lessons or from other sources, do not type the prompt, only the commands that follow it. To simplify, you can execute some commonly used backend commands directly in FortiWeb CLI, without enabling shell-access and adding username/password. On 7.0.3 and previous builds, below commands are supported: FortiWeb # fnsysctl. Below are the usable commands: basename cat date df …

WebMar 31, 2024 · Shebang is a combination of bash # and bang ! followed the the bash shell path. This is the first line of the script. Shebang tells the shell to execute it via bash shell. Go to the Apache Spark Installation directory from the command line and type bin/spark-shell and press enter, this launches Spark shell and gives you a scala prompt to interact with Spark in scala language.
